Takeaways from the Vikings’ win over the Lions
The Vikings improved to 4-4 after a team effort highlighted by J.J. McCarthy’s 143 passing yards and two touchdowns in his third NFL start.
- On Sunday, the Minnesota Vikings upset the Detroit Lions 27-24, returning home with a 4-4 record after a collective effort reflecting head coach Kevin O'Connell's culture.
- After a primetime loss to the Los Angeles Chargers, critics questioned the Vikings' defense, and that collapse made the response against the Lions crucial to get the Minnesota Vikings back on track.
- Quarterback J.J. McCarthy completed 4 of 25 passes for 143 yards with two passing TDs and a rushing score, while Aaron Jones played effectively before a shoulder injury, and rookie Myles Price had a 61-yard return.
- The defense produced an interior pass rush that created game-changing moments, with Javon Hargrave disrupting Detroit, and J.J. McCarthy must stay healthy to continue developing.
- Justin Jefferson's early catch opened opportunities for Jordan Addison and T.J. Hockenson, Jordan Mason's emergence adds depth, but Aaron Jones brings a dynamic element the Vikings lack without him and penalties limited some of Jones's statistical impact.

Takeaways from the Vikings’ win over the Lions
DETROIT — All of a sudden, the Minnesota Vikings are right back in the fight. After leaving the Twin Cities last weekend with roughly a million questions surrounding this particular group, the Vikings returned home with a 4-4 record following a 27-24 upset win over the Detroit Lions. The highly anticipated return of young quarterback J.J. McCarthy couldn’t have gone much better. He completed 14 of 25 passes for 143 yards and a pair of touchdowns…
